Just because someone doesn't speak English well or at all doesn't mean they shouldn't receive quality substance abuse treatment in a top-notch drug rehabilitation facility. Clients that don't speak English should obtain rehab services which are just as effective as they are for English speaking clients, and that's why there are alcohol and drug rehab centers available to cater to clients who speak other languages. Rehab information is furnished in drug and alcohol rehabilitation centers across the nation in a number of languages. So even if the drug and alcohol rehab facility of preference isn't exclusively accessible in a specific language, there are many facilities that offer English services but also have rehabilitation professionals working that speak other languages. Individuals who speak other languages can take part in some of the most workable programs around, like inpatient and residential drug treatment facilities which deliver rehab using their language. The rehabs that offer rehabilitation in other languages may also be often sensitive to the cultural needs of their clients, and still provide amenities and an environment to help accommodate these needs if possible.
